	/**
	 * Checks an uploaded for suspicious naming and potential PHP contents which could indicate a hacking attempt.
	 *
	 * The options you can define are:
	 * null_byte                   Prevent files with a null byte in their name (buffer overflow attack)
	 * forbidden_extensions        Do not allow these strings anywhere in the file's extension
	 * php_tag_in_content          Do not allow `<?php` tag in content
	 * phar_stub_in_content        Do not allow the `__HALT_COMPILER()` phar stub in content
	 * shorttag_in_content         Do not allow short tag `<?` in content
	 * shorttag_extensions         Which file extensions to scan for short tags in content
	 * fobidden_ext_in_content     Do not allow forbidden_extensions anywhere in content
	 * php_ext_content_extensions  Which file extensions to scan for .php in content
	 *
	 * This code is an adaptation and improvement of Admin Tools' UploadShield feature,
	 * relicensed and contributed by its author.
	 *
	 * @param   array  $file     An uploaded file descriptor
	 * @param   array  $options  The scanner options (see the code for details)
	 *
	 * @return  boolean  True of the file is safe
	 *
	 * @since   3.4
	 */
	public static function isSafeFile($file, $options = array())
	{
		$defaultOptions = array(

			// Null byte in file name
			'null_byte'                  => true,

			// Forbidden string in extension (e.g. php matched .php, .xxx.php, .php.xxx and so on)
			'forbidden_extensions'       => array(
				'php', 'phps', 'pht', 'phtml', 'php3', 'php4', 'php5', 'php6', 'php7', 'phar', 'inc', 'pl', 'cgi', 'fcgi', 'java', 'jar', 'py',
			),

			// <?php tag in file contents
			'php_tag_in_content'         => true,

			// <? tag in file contents
			'shorttag_in_content'        => true,

			// __HALT_COMPILER()
			'phar_stub_in_content'        => true,

			// Which file extensions to scan for short tags
			'shorttag_extensions'        => array(
				'inc', 'phps', 'class', 'php3', 'php4', 'php5', 'txt', 'dat', 'tpl', 'tmpl',
			),

			// Forbidden extensions anywhere in the content
			'fobidden_ext_in_content'    => true,

			// Which file extensions to scan for .php in the content
			'php_ext_content_extensions' => array('zip', 'rar', 'tar', 'gz', 'tgz', 'bz2', 'tbz', 'jpa'),
		);

		$options = array_merge($defaultOptions, $options);

		// Make sure we can scan nested file descriptors
		$descriptors = $file;

		if (isset($file['name']) && isset($file['tmp_name']))
		{
			$descriptors = self::decodeFileData(
				array(
					$file['name'],
					$file['type'],
					$file['tmp_name'],
					$file['error'],
					$file['size'],
				)
			);
		}

		// Handle non-nested descriptors (single files)
		if (isset($descriptors['name']))
		{
			$descriptors = array($descriptors);
		}

		// Scan all descriptors detected
		foreach ($descriptors as $fileDescriptor)
		{
			if (!isset($fileDescriptor['name']))
			{
				// This is a nested descriptor. We have to recurse.
				if (!self::isSafeFile($fileDescriptor, $options))
				{
					return false;
				}

				continue;
			}

			$tempNames     = $fileDescriptor['tmp_name'];
			$intendedNames = $fileDescriptor['name'];

			if (!is_array($tempNames))
			{
				$tempNames = array($tempNames);
			}

			if (!is_array($intendedNames))
			{
				$intendedNames = array($intendedNames);
			}

			$len = count($tempNames);

			for ($i = 0; $i < $len; $i++)
			{
				$tempName     = array_shift($tempNames);
				$intendedName = array_shift($intendedNames);

				// 1. Null byte check
				if ($options['null_byte'])
				{
					if (strstr($intendedName, "\x00"))
					{
						return false;
					}
				}

				// 2. PHP-in-extension check (.php, .php.xxx[.yyy[.zzz[...]]], .xxx[.yyy[.zzz[...]]].php)
				if (!empty($options['forbidden_extensions']))
				{
					$explodedName = explode('.', $intendedName);
					$explodedName =	array_reverse($explodedName);
					array_pop($explodedName);
					$explodedName = array_map('strtolower', $explodedName);

					/*
					 * DO NOT USE array_intersect HERE! array_intersect expects the two arrays to
					 * be set, i.e. they should have unique values.
					 */
					foreach ($options['forbidden_extensions'] as $ext)
					{
						if (in_array($ext, $explodedName))
						{
							return false;
						}
					}
				}

				// 3. File contents scanner (PHP tag in file contents)
				if ($options['php_tag_in_content']
					|| $options['shorttag_in_content'] || $options['phar_stub_in_content']
					|| ($options['fobidden_ext_in_content'] && !empty($options['forbidden_extensions'])))
				{
					$fp = @fopen($tempName, 'r');

					if ($fp !== false)
					{
						$data = '';

						while (!feof($fp))
						{
							$data .= @fread($fp, 131072);

							if ($options['php_tag_in_content'] && stripos($data, '<?php') !== false)
							{
								return false;
							}

							if ($options['phar_stub_in_content'] && stripos($data, '__HALT_COMPILER()') !== false)
							{
								return false;
							}

							if ($options['shorttag_in_content'])
							{
								$suspiciousExtensions = $options['shorttag_extensions'];

								if (empty($suspiciousExtensions))
								{
									$suspiciousExtensions = array(
										'inc', 'phps', 'class', 'php3', 'php4', 'txt', 'dat', 'tpl', 'tmpl',
									);
								}

								/*
								 * DO NOT USE array_intersect HERE! array_intersect expects the two arrays to
								 * be set, i.e. they should have unique values.
								 */
								$collide = false;

								foreach ($suspiciousExtensions as $ext)
								{
									if (in_array($ext, $explodedName))
									{
										$collide = true;

										break;
									}
								}

								if ($collide)
								{
									// These are suspicious text files which may have the short tag (<?) in them
									if (strstr($data, '<?'))
									{
										return false;
									}
								}
							}

							if ($options['fobidden_ext_in_content'] && !empty($options['forbidden_extensions']))
							{
								$suspiciousExtensions = $options['php_ext_content_extensions'];

								if (empty($suspiciousExtensions))
								{
									$suspiciousExtensions = array(
										'zip', 'rar', 'tar', 'gz', 'tgz', 'bz2', 'tbz', 'jpa',
									);
								}

								/*
								 * DO NOT USE array_intersect HERE! array_intersect expects the two arrays to
								 * be set, i.e. they should have unique values.
								 */
								$collide = false;

								foreach ($suspiciousExtensions as $ext)
								{
									if (in_array($ext, $explodedName))
									{
										$collide = true;

										break;
									}
								}

								if ($collide)
								{
									/*
									 * These are suspicious text files which may have an executable
									 * file extension in them
									 */
									foreach ($options['forbidden_extensions'] as $ext)
									{
										if (strstr($data, '.' . $ext))
										{
											return false;
										}
									}
								}
							}

							/*
							 * This makes sure that we don't accidentally skip a <?php tag if it's across
							 * a read boundary, even on multibyte strings
							 */
							$data = substr($data, -10);
						}

						fclose($fp);
					}
				}
			}
		}

		return true;
	}
